For the 2024 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 2,775 students in Reynolds SD 7 School District.
Public High Schools in Reynolds SD 7 School District have a diversity score of 0.69, which is more than the Oregon public high school average of 0.57.
Public High School in Reynolds SD 7 School District have a Graduation Rate of 57%, which is less than the Oregon average of 82%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Reynolds High School, with 62%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Oregon or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 73%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Oregon public high school average of 39%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$17,118 in this school district is less than the state median of $18,279. The school district revenue/student has grown by 16%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$16,757 is less than the state median of $19,325. The school district spending/student has grown by 8% over four school years.
